All of the following statements regarding NPV are true EXCEPT:
a. A positive NPV indicates the present value of the cash flows exceeds the initial investment.
b. A negative NPV indicates the present value of the cash flows is less than the initial investment.
c. An NPV equal to zero indicates the present value of the cash flows is equal to the initial investment.
d. The internal rate of return is the discount rate that causes the initial investment to exceed the present value of the cash flows.
